The Delaware County District Library is offering three sessions later this week to introduce patrons to The Maker Studio.

These classes, to be held on July 5, will focus on Vector Design Basics, Engraved Garden Markers, and a 3D Printing Demo. More information on each can be obtained here:

The staff at the Delaware County District Library’s (DCDL) Main and Liberty Branch libraries will provide you with the training to independently operate all the equipment in our Maker Studios. These creative spaces are equipped with specialized tools like 3D printers, vinyl cutters, a sublimation printer, a laser cutter/engraver, sewing machines, and more. Plus, we have computers that come with design software.

Although the Maker Studios are designed as DIY areas, staff will be there to guide you through the initial stages, helping you make your design ideas a reality. Once you are comfortable with the tools, you can work on your future projects independently.

The Maker Studios are open to the public during designated lab hours. However, it is important to note that not all tools are accessible at each location. For specifics on equipment availability, please check the location tabs at each branch.
